How long can a weight loss STALL last anyhow?
I know stalls happen & you go thru them, but I wonder how long is too long to be hanging out at the same weight?
I've lost approx. 88 lbs since surgery in early March. I feel great and think that I'm doing pretty good. My goal weight loss is around 110-120 lbs. though, so I've got some more lbs. to lose. I'm closing in on my 6 months out from surgery date and I think 88 lbs is good. I know I'll get there one day, but these weight loss stalls are hard to deal with. I guess weight loss really slows down when you reach 6 months out or so. I'll have to "wait" this stall out and hopefully get back to losing again. It's just a bit disappointing to see the same weight and not see that needle budge too much. Just wondering if anyone else has experienced this too.

You plateu...Lose a bout 1-3 lbs then "level out" and stall for about a week or two...Repeat, repeat, repeat.
it WILL come off. Every newbie under a year is so terrified that THEIR WLS is broken. When I hit my stalls I used the search feature above...Types in "Stall" and found literally HUNREDS of posts about it...Making me feel that it is very normal indeed.

Don't worry.. and have you taken your measurements? I know it's strange, but I only seemed to really lose inches during the times when the number on the scale wasn't moving.
I just lost a pants size and I actually gained two pounds this week. *sigh* My body is a mystery to me. =]
